Chicken Wonton Cups Recipe

Ingredients:

36 wonton wrappers
cooking spray
1 1/2 c. shredded cooked chicken breasts
1 pkg. (8 oz.) reduced fat cream cheese
1/2 c. shredded Parmesan cheese
1/3 c. reduced fat mayonnaise
1 can (4 oz.) chopped green chilies, undrained
1 jalapeño pepper, seeded and minced

Directions:

Press wonton wrappers into miniature muffin cups coated with cooking spray. Spritz wrappers with cooking spray. Bake at 350º for 5-6 minutes or until edges begin to brown.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ine the chicken, cream cheese, Parmesan cheese, mayonnaise, chilies, and jalapeño. Spoon chicken mixture into cups. Bake 8-10 minutes longer or until filling is heated through. Serve warm. Refrigerate leftovers.
